Celebrating our Summer 2025 cohort Nurse Residency Graduates! 🩺

We’re proud to recognize our newest Nurse Residency Program graduates, a dedicated group of 50 early-career nurses reaching an important milestone.

Last week, they presented their evidence-based practice (EBP) projects, showcasing their commitment to improving patient care and advancing nursing practice.

Through this one-year program, these nurses strengthened their clinical judgment, critical thinking, and leadership skills, all essential to delivering high-quality care.

Celebrating the Future of Nursing at UTMB! 🩺

One month ago, the UTMB School of Nursing in Galveston welcomed 100 future nurses during their White Coat Ceremony, marking the start of a journey grounded in compassion, resilience, and purpose.

Chief Nursing Information Officer Kandice Bledsaw, PhD, RN, delivered an inspiring keynote, encouraging the next generation as they begin their nursing careers.

This moment was especially meaningful, as Dr. Bledsaw stood in their place just 10 years ago in Levin Hall. Reflecting on the significance of this milestone, Dr. Bledsaw shared:

"I am both humbled and inspired as I reflect on the honor of delivering the UTMB School of Nursing White Coat Ceremony keynote on the 10th anniversary of donning my own white coat on the very same stage in Levin Hall.

The White Coat Ceremony represents more than a milestone; it symbolizes a commitment to compassion, lifelong learning, and the incredible responsibility we carry as part of the nursing profession.

Standing alongside future nurses reminded me of my own journey; of the moments that shaped me, the challenges that strengthened me, and the purpose and passion that continue to guide me.

Today, as a nurse leader, it is especially meaningful to witness the UTMB nursing journey and to recognize that each of you is already a leader that contributes to the growth of that journey.

Growth is a lifelong commitment to excellence challenging us to continually push ourselves to be better for our patients, our teams, and the communities we serve. I am endlessly inspired by those who lead in both big and small moments, shaping the future of nursing at UTMB through their dedication and unwavering commitment to quality, safety, and experience.

Leadership in nursing is not defined by a title, but by the difference we make in the lives of others. Lead from where you are! The future of nursing is strong because of you."

🎉 Join us in congratulating our newest Marshall-Watson Award recipient, John Moreno, RN, BSN, NC III, at Hospital Galveston!

In partnership with the UTMB School of Nursing in Galveston and Nursing Service, the Marshall-Watson Award for Excellence in Preceptorship recognizes nurse clinicians who go above and beyond to mentor and shape the next generation of nurses.

John’s dedication to nursing excellence, leadership, and preceptorship makes a lasting impact on his team and future nurses alike.

"Many of our strongest team members credit their success to John’s steady presence and ongoing mentorship. John is also the go to person for all things on the unit. Whether it’s clinical questions, workflow challenges, or unexpected issues. Staff consistently turn to him because they trust his judgment, knowledge, and calm problem solving approach."

We’re proud to honor John Moreno as the 2026 Marshall-Watson Award recipient for his exceptional commitment to guiding and supporting future nursing professionals.
